Biography of Sammy Sosa
Sammy Sosa was born on November 12, 1968, in San Pedro de Macorís, Dominican Republic. He embarked on his Major League Baseball career in 1989 and quickly became a celebrated athlete, especially during the historic home run race of 1998 when he competed against Mark McGwire. Sosa's illustrious career is marked by numerous achievements, including:
- Three-time All-Star
- 1998 National League MVP
- 600 career home runs
Personal Data and Biodata
Full Name | Samuel Peralta Sosa |
---|---|
Date of Birth | November 12, 1968 |
Place of Birth | San Pedro de Macorís, Dominican Republic |
Position | Right fielder |
Major Teams | Chicago Cubs, Chicago White Sox, Texas Rangers |
Understanding Skin Bleaching
Skin bleaching refers to the practice of using chemical substances to lighten one's skin tone. This phenomenon is prevalent in various cultures, particularly in regions of Africa, Asia, and the Caribbean, where lighter skin is often associated with beauty and elevated social status. Common agents utilized in skin bleaching include:
- Hydroquinone
- Corticosteroids
- Mercury
While some individuals may pursue skin bleaching for aesthetic purposes, it is crucial to acknowledge the potential health risks linked to these products, such as skin damage and other serious health concerns.
Sammy Sosa's Experience with Skin Bleaching
Sammy Sosa's skin transformation became evident in the late 2000s, drawing extensive media coverage and public scrutiny. Initially, Sosa attributed his lighter skin tone to a moisturizer, sparking curiosity and skepticism. Over the years, he has encountered both criticism and support from various quarters, with many questioning the motivations behind his decision to bleach his skin.
In interviews, Sosa has stressed that his choice was a matter of personal preference rather than societal pressure. However, this has not entirely alleviated the backlash he has received from fans and critics. His actions have ignited discussions about identity, race, and the cultural significance of skin tone in the Dominican Republic and beyond.

Cultural Implications of Skin Bleaching
Skin bleaching raises significant questions about cultural identity and self-acceptance. In many societies, lighter skin is often equated with higher social status, leading some individuals to pursue lighter skin through various means. The implications of this trend are profound, as they can perpetuate stereotypes and contribute to systemic racism.
In the context of the Dominican Republic, Sosa's actions reflect a broader cultural narrative where lighter skin is often favored. This preference can result in internalized racism and a lack of appreciation for darker skin tones. Addressing these issues requires open dialogue and education about beauty standards, self-acceptance, and the importance of diversity.
Health Risks Associated with Skin Bleaching
The use of skin-bleaching products can pose several health risks, many of which are not widely known. Some potential dangers include:
- Skin irritation and allergic reactions
- Increased risk of skin infections
- Long-term skin damage and discoloration
- Kidney and liver damage from harmful chemicals
Health organizations have cautioned against the use of unregulated products, emphasizing the importance of seeking safe and effective alternatives for skin care. Understanding the risks associated with skin bleaching is essential for individuals considering these practices.
